New biodegradable polymer fabricated using guar gum, and chitosan has high potential for packaging material

New Delhi, October 11, 2021: A team of Indian scientists have developed an environmentally friendly, non-toxic, biodegradable polymer using guar gum and chitosan, both of which are polysaccharides extracted from guar beans and shells of crab and shrimps. New electronic nose with biodegradable polymer and monomer can detect hydrogen sulphide from sewers

New Delhi, April 17, 2021: Scientists have developed an electronic nose with biodegradable polymer and monomer that can detect hydrogen sulphide (H2S), a poisonous, corrosive, and flammable gas produced from swamps and sewers.
